1. What is an Engineering Manager at Apptio?
As an Engineering Manager at Apptio, you are stepping into a pivotal leadership role at the forefront of Technology Business Management (TBM) and FinOps. Apptio builds powerful SaaS applications that empower CIOs and IT leaders to manage billions of dollars in technology spend, optimize cloud investments, and drive strategic business value. In this role, you are the bridge between complex technical execution and high-level business strategy.
Your impact spans across products, users, and the internal engineering culture. You will guide teams of highly capable engineers to build scalable, data-heavy applications that process massive financial and operational datasets. Because Apptio products are mission-critical for enterprise customers, the engineering standards are exceptionally high. You will be responsible for ensuring architectural integrity, driving agile delivery, and fostering an environment of continuous innovation.
What makes this role uniquely compelling is the blend of deep technical oversight and strategic influence. You are not just managing ticket queues; you are actively shaping how your team approaches complex data problems, how they collaborate with product managers to define roadmaps, and how your engineering pod scales to meet the demands of enterprise-grade software. You will be challenged to think like a technologist, a product owner, and a business leader simultaneously.
2. Getting Ready for Your Interviews
Thorough preparation is the key to navigating the Apptio interview loop with confidence. Our process is designed to be rigorous, thought-provoking, and deeply aligned with our core business objectives. You should approach your preparation by understanding the specific dimensions we evaluate.
Role-Related Knowledge In the context of Apptio, this means demonstrating a strong grasp of distributed systems, cloud architecture, and data processing. Interviewers will evaluate your ability to guide technical decisions, review architectural trade-offs, and ensure your team builds scalable, secure SaaS products. You can demonstrate strength here by grounding your answers in real-world examples of systems you have successfully scaled or stabilized.
Problem-Solving Ability We look for managers who can navigate ambiguity, especially when dealing with complex enterprise data challenges. Interviewers will assess how you break down large, undefined problems into actionable engineering tasks. You will stand out by showing a structured, analytical approach to troubleshooting, system design, and project planning.
Leadership and Execution This criterion focuses on your ability to build, mentor, and motivate high-performing engineering teams. We evaluate your track record of delivering software on time, managing cross-functional stakeholder expectations, and resolving team conflicts. Strong candidates highlight their frameworks for performance management, agile delivery, and fostering an inclusive engineering culture.
Culture Fit and Values Apptio thrives on collaboration, innovation, and a distinct focus on customer value within the TBM space. Interviewers want to see that you are personable, highly communicative, and adaptable. You can demonstrate this by showing genuine curiosity about our products, asking insightful questions, and proving you can thrive in a fast-paced, accelerating tech environment.
3. Interview Process Overview
The interview journey for an Engineering Manager at Apptio is comprehensive and typically structured to evaluate both your technical depth and your leadership capabilities. You will begin with an initial phone screen with a recruiter, which focuses on your background, high-level fit, and logistical alignment. If successful, this is quickly followed by a longer, deep-dive conversation with the hiring manager. This stage is critical; the hiring manager will probe into your past experiences, your management philosophy, and how your skills align with the specific needs of the team.
Following the hiring manager screen, candidates are often required to complete a timed cognitive and personality assessment. This is a standard procedure for many roles within our organizational structure and is used to gather baseline data on problem-solving approaches and working styles. Once completed, you will move to the final onsite loop (conducted virtually or in-office). This loop generally consists of four to six 30-minute interviews with a cross-functional panel, including peer engineering managers, direct reports, product partners, and often a Director or VP.
A distinguishing feature of the Apptio process for management roles is the presentation stage. During your final loop, you may be given a set of data to analyze and present to a panel. This exercise tests your ability to synthesize information, communicate strategic insights, and handle live Q&A from senior leadership.
The visual timeline above outlines the typical progression from the initial recruiter screen through the final leadership presentation. Use this to pace your preparation, ensuring you allocate dedicated time to practice data analysis and presentation skills before the final loop. Keep in mind that the full process can sometimes span several weeks, so maintaining momentum and clear communication with your recruiter is essential.
4. Deep Dive into Evaluation Areas
Technical Leadership & Architecture
As an Engineering Manager, you are expected to be the technical anchor for your team. While you may not be writing production code daily, you must be capable of guiding architectural discussions, identifying bottlenecks in data-heavy applications, and ensuring technical excellence. Interviewers want to see that you can balance short-term product delivery with long-term technical debt management.
Be ready to go over:
- System Design Trade-offs – Evaluating monolithic versus microservices architectures, data storage solutions, and cloud infrastructure choices.
- Scaling SaaS Applications – Strategies for handling increased load, ensuring high availability, and optimizing performance for enterprise customers.
- Engineering Excellence – Implementing robust CI/CD pipelines, automated testing frameworks, and site reliability practices.
- Advanced concepts (less common):
- Multi-tenant architecture design patterns.
- Complex data ingestion and ETL pipeline optimization.
Example questions or scenarios:
- "Walk me through a time you had to pivot your team's architectural approach mid-project. How did you manage the technical and business trade-offs?"
- "How do you ensure your team maintains high code quality while meeting aggressive product deadlines?"
- "Describe a complex system your team built. What were the failure points, and how did you architect around them?"
People Management & Team Building
Your ability to grow and inspire engineers is paramount at Apptio. Interviewers will dig deep into your coaching style, your approach to hiring, and how you handle underperformance. Strong performance in this area means providing specific, nuanced examples rather than generic management platitudes. We want to know how you build trust and psychological safety.
Be ready to go over:
- Performance Management – Navigating both low performers and high-achieving engineers who are ready for promotion.
- Hiring and Scaling Teams – Your philosophy on interviewing, onboarding, and retaining top engineering talent.
- Conflict Resolution – Mediating disagreements between engineers or between engineering and product teams.
Example questions or scenarios:
- "Tell me about a time you had to manage out an underperforming engineer. What was your process, and what did you learn?"
- "How do you keep your team motivated when working on legacy code or maintenance tasks?"
- "Give an example of how you resolved a deep technical disagreement between two senior engineers on your team."
Data Analysis & Strategic Communication
Because Apptio operates in the TBM and FinOps space, our leaders must be highly analytical and capable of translating data into actionable business strategy. The presentation round specifically targets this skill. You will be evaluated on your ability to quickly comprehend a dataset, draw logical conclusions, and present your findings confidently to a panel of peers and executives.
Be ready to go over:
- Data Synthesis – Identifying trends, anomalies, and key performance indicators within an ambiguous dataset.
- Executive Presentation – Structuring a narrative that is clear, concise, and tailored to a non-technical or executive audience.
- Defending Decisions – Handling pushback and answering probing questions about your methodology and conclusions.
Example questions or scenarios:
- "Present your analysis of this provided dataset: what are the three most critical insights, and what engineering initiatives would you prioritize based on them?"
- "How do you communicate technical delays or roadblocks to non-technical stakeholders?"
- "Tell me about a time you used data to change the mind of a senior leader."
5. Key Responsibilities
As an Engineering Manager at Apptio, your day-to-day work revolves around driving the successful delivery of complex software while cultivating a healthy, high-performing team. You will lead one or more engineering pods, acting as the primary point of accountability for your team's output. This involves leading agile ceremonies, conducting architectural reviews, and ensuring that technical execution aligns tightly with the product roadmap.
Collaboration is deeply embedded in this role. You will partner closely with Product Managers to define scope, prioritize the backlog, and negotiate timelines. You will also work alongside UX/UI designers and QA teams to ensure that the features your team builds meet Apptio's high standards for enterprise usability and reliability. Much of your time will be spent unblocking your engineers, translating business requirements into technical milestones, and shielding your team from unnecessary distractions.
Beyond project delivery, you are a dedicated people leader. You will hold regular 1-on-1s, guide career development, and foster an inclusive culture where engineers feel empowered to innovate. You will also play a crucial role in recruiting, interviewing, and onboarding new talent as Apptio continues to accelerate and scale its operations.
6. Role Requirements & Qualifications
To be competitive for the Engineering Manager position at Apptio, you must bring a strong blend of technical acumen and proven leadership experience. We look for candidates who have successfully transitioned from senior individual contributor roles into management, demonstrating a clear understanding of enterprise software development.
- Must-have skills – A minimum of 3–5 years of direct people management experience in a software engineering environment. Deep familiarity with agile development methodologies, cloud infrastructure (AWS, Azure, or GCP), and modern architectural patterns. Strong analytical skills and the ability to communicate complex technical concepts to diverse stakeholders.
- Nice-to-have skills – Prior experience in the FinOps, TBM, or financial technology sectors. Familiarity with managing globally distributed teams. Experience leading teams through significant scaling phases or architectural migrations.
Your soft skills are just as critical as your technical background. You must possess high emotional intelligence, a collaborative mindset, and the resilience to navigate the ambiguities of a fast-paced, accelerating tech company.
7. Common Interview Questions
The questions below represent the types of inquiries you will face during your Apptio interviews. While you should not memorize answers, use these to identify patterns in what we value and to structure your own experiences into compelling narratives.
Leadership & People Management
This category tests your direct management experience, your empathy, and your frameworks for building strong teams.
- How do you balance feature delivery with paying down technical debt?
- Tell me about the most difficult team you had to lead. What made it difficult and how did you turn it around?
- Walk me through your process for onboarding a new engineer and getting them to productivity.
- Describe a time you had to advocate for your team to senior leadership.
- How do you handle a situation where a product manager is pushing for an unrealistic deadline?
System Design & Technical Strategy
These questions evaluate your ability to guide technical decisions and ensure your team builds scalable, reliable software.
- How would you design a system to ingest and process millions of financial transactions daily?
- Tell me about a time a system your team owned failed in production. What was the root cause and how did you handle the post-mortem?
- How do you evaluate when to build a solution in-house versus buying an off-the-shelf product?
- Describe your approach to ensuring security and compliance in a cloud-based SaaS application.
Behavioral & Culture Fit
We want to see how you navigate ambiguity, communicate, and align with Apptio's culture of innovation.
- Tell me about a time you had to make a critical decision with incomplete data.
- Describe a situation where you failed. What did you learn and how did you apply that learning later?
- Why are you interested in the TBM/FinOps space, and why Apptio specifically?
- How do you foster a culture of innovation within a team that is bogged down by maintenance work?
8. Frequently Asked Questions
Q: Is the cognitive and personality assessment mandatory, and how should I prepare for it? Yes, the cognitive and personality assessment is a standard requirement early in the process for many candidates. It typically consists of timed logic puzzles and behavioral questions. You cannot explicitly study for it, but practicing standard timed logic exercises online can help you feel more comfortable with the format and pace.
Q: How long does the interview process typically take? The timeline can vary, but candidates often experience a process spanning 4 to 8 weeks from the initial recruiter screen to the final offer stage. Apptio values thoroughness, particularly for leadership roles, so patience and consistent follow-up with your recruiter are highly recommended.
Q: What is the format of the presentation round? During the final onsite loop, you will likely be given a dataset or a prompt to analyze prior to your interview. You will present your findings, strategic recommendations, and potential engineering initiatives to a panel. Expect interactive Q&A where you will need to defend your assumptions and methodologies.
Q: What differentiates a successful Engineering Manager candidate at Apptio? Successful candidates seamlessly blend deep technical credibility with exceptional business communication. They don't just know how to build software; they understand why it matters to the business and can articulate that vision to their team. They also demonstrate a highly structured approach to problem-solving.
9. Other General Tips
- Master the STAR Method: When answering behavioral questions, strictly follow the Situation, Task, Action, Result framework. Apptio interviewers appreciate concise, structured answers that clearly highlight your specific contributions and measurable outcomes.
- Embrace the Data: Apptio is a data-driven company. Whenever possible, use metrics to quantify your past successes. Talk about team velocity, system latency improvements, or retention rates rather than just speaking in generalities.
- Prepare for the Panel: During your final loop, you will speak with a variety of roles (peers, reports, product, VPs). Tailor your communication style to your audience. A deep technical dive is appropriate for a peer EM, but a VP will care more about strategic impact and cross-functional alignment.
- Ask Insightful Questions: The interview is a two-way street. Ask your interviewers about the specific challenges their teams are facing, the roadmap for their product area, or how they measure engineering success. This demonstrates active interest in the role and the company's future.
10. Summary & Next Steps
Joining Apptio as an Engineering Manager is an opportunity to lead high-performing teams in a dynamic, accelerating sector of the tech industry. You will be challenged to solve complex data problems, scale enterprise-grade SaaS products, and shape the engineering culture of a company that is at the top of its game in the TBM space. The work is demanding, but the impact you will have on both your engineers and the broader business is profound.
The compensation data above provides a benchmark for the Engineering Manager role. Keep in mind that total compensation packages typically include a mix of base salary, performance bonuses, and equity components, which will scale based on your seniority, location, and the specific scope of your team.
As you prepare, focus heavily on structuring your past experiences into clear, data-backed narratives. Practice your system design discussions, refine your approach to team leadership, and be ready to showcase your analytical skills during the presentation round. Remember that focused, deliberate preparation will materially improve your performance and confidence. For further insights, peer experiences, and targeted preparation tools, continue exploring the resources available on Dataford. You have the background and the potential to succeed—now it is time to prove it.
